Carrot Fertility launches supplier matching platform CarrotMatch

Carrot Fertility, a worldwide fertility and family-building platform, introduced the launch of its maternity-focused supplier matching platform, CarrotMatch.

Carrot is a platform for employers to offer expanded entry to care from maternity to menopause, and pre-pregnancy by means of parenting. 

It presents companies for gestational surrogacy, adoption, being pregnant and postpartum care, parenting and return to work, menopause/low testosterone, IVF and IUI, and egg, sperm and embryo freezing.   

CarrotMatch makes use of distinctive datasets with greater than 200 metrics to attain suppliers on high quality, value of care and established outcomes. It then matches Carrot’s members to a supplier in response to their wants. 

The corporate touts that suppliers on CarrotMatch “should outperform their native friends in all key classes” and that the platform integrates social determinants of well being and connects sufferers to native assets if the person lacks entry to meals, transportation or youngster care. 

“The selection of who to go to for care is an important determination a Carrot member could make in figuring out their total affected person expertise, scientific outcomes, and whole value of care,” James Wong, chief outcomes officer at Carrot Fertility, mentioned in an announcement.

“CarrotMatch provides individuals the power to pick out high-quality suppliers primarily based on scientific information and keep away from suppliers who overvalue surgical paths, have poor outcomes, larger complication charges, provide inconsistent or excessive pricing, or just create a poor expertise.”

THE LARGER TREND

The typical age of girls first giving delivery has continued to rise over time, and about 42% of adults have used fertility remedies or know somebody who has, in response to a Pew Analysis Heart survey.

In 2021, Carrot scored $75 million in Sequence C funding, a 12 months after securing $24 million in Sequence B funding.

Different corporations providing family-building companies embrace perimenopause- and menopause-focused digital care specialist Midi Well being, which introduced an unique collaboration with New York’s Mount Sinai Well being System earlier this week to offer therapy and specialised care plans for the well being system’s sufferers.

In April, Midi secured $60 million in Sequence B funding, bringing its whole elevate to $100 million. Lower than a 12 months earlier than, Midi secured $25 million in a Sequence A spherical. 

Evernow is one other firm within the area that provides menopause-focused telehealth, and London-based worker well being platform Peppy supplies menopause, being pregnant, fertility and early parenthood companies.
